I am very new to Houdini but I am trying to make a whale breaching. My problem is when I render I get theses weird black spots on my model. I think they are shadows but I am unsure. I have attached an image of the render below.

To me, this doesn't really look like a shadow, more like artifacts from the model. In Mantra, you can enable some different AOVS in the Extra Image Planes Tab to see where this is coming from if this is connected to shadows/rendering. Otherwise, I would take a deeper look at the model and textures that came with it. I've experienced cases where textures/geo would break after adding subdivision because the model wasn't set up properly.

It almost looks like two different versions of the model are superimposed. Double-check render candidates to make sure collision and other not-to-be-rendered objects are hidden.
